Isabel Epps Brissie
Isabel Epps Brissie, 89, of Hendersonville, went to be with her Lord and Savior, Jesus Christ on Friday, Nov. 4, 2005, at Pardee Care Center after an extended illness.
Born in Fort Mill, S.C., she was the daughter of the late Walter Monroe and Maggie Stevens Epps. She lived all of her life in Fort Mill until she and her husband moved to Hendersonville 11 years ago. She served faithfully as a church secretary for 17 years at Fort Mill First Baptist Church and was very active in many church activities. Singing in the church choir was one of her many church pleasures. She retired from Winthrop University.
She is survived by her husband of 68 years, James C. Brissie; a son, James C. Brissie Jr. and his wife, Libby, of Hendersonville; a granddaughter, Kelda Bowers and her husband, Jerry, of Asheville; a grandson, Jimmy Brissie and his wife, Rhonda, of Hendersonville; a great-granddaughter, Anna Sgibnev and her husband, Constantine; and great-grandson, Tanner Bowers; a brother, Steven Epps of Lancaster, S.C.; several sisters-in-law and many nieces and nephews. She was preceded in death by four sisters, Vernie Bayne, Beulah Bennett, Ethylin Broadnax, Florine Epps and two brothers, Andy and Billy Epps.
"Mama" had a very sweet gentle spirit and was dearly loved by all her family.
